Classic Ground Beef Tacos Recipes for Weeknight Dinners
Ground beef tacos are a timeless favorite. They’re easy to make and always a hit. This recipe is perfect for busy families or anyone looking for a comforting meal.
Ingredients You’ll Need
To make these delicious tacos, you’ll need the following ingredients:
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 medium onion, diced
- 1 packet of taco seasoning
- 8-10 taco shells
- Shredded cheese, lettuce, diced tomatoes, and any other taco toppings you like
Using high-quality ground beef and fresh toppings can make a big difference in the flavor of your tacos.
Step-by-Step Preparation
Cooking these tacos is straightforward. First, brown the ground beef in a pan over medium-high heat. Once it’s fully browned, add the diced onion and cook until it’s translucent. Then, add the taco seasoning and follow the package instructions. While the beef is cooking, warm the taco shells according to the package directions.

Step | Action | Time |
---|---|---|
1 | Brown ground beef | 5 minutes |
2 | Add onion and cook | 3 minutes |
3 | Add taco seasoning | 2 minutes |
Serving Suggestions
Once everything is ready, assemble the tacos. Spoon the beef mixture into the warmed shells. Top with your favorite toppings. For an extra burst of flavor, add a squeeze of fresh lime juice or a sprinkle of cilantro.

30-Minute Chicken Tacos with Homemade Seasoning
Craving tacos but short on time? My 30-minute chicken tacos recipe is the perfect solution. With a blend of spices and a straightforward cooking process, you can enjoy delicious homemade tacos in no time.
Ingredients List
To make these tasty tacos, you’ll need the following ingredients:
- 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 2 tablespoons homemade taco seasoning (a mix of chili powder, cumin, paprika, and more)
- 8-10 corn tortillas
- Optional toppings: diced tomatoes, shredded lettuce, diced avocado, sour cream, and salsa
Preparation Method
Preparing your 30-minute chicken tacos is simple:
- Slice the chicken into thin strips and season with the homemade taco seasoning.
- Heat a skillet over medium-high heat and cook the chicken until it’s fully cooked.
- Warm the tortillas by wrapping them in a damp paper towel and microwaving for 20-30 seconds.
- Assemble your tacos with the cooked chicken and your choice of toppings.
Flavor Variations
To mix things up, try these flavor variations:
- Add diced onions or bell peppers to the skillet with the chicken for extra flavor.
- Use different types of hot peppers or sriracha to add a spicy kick.
- Experiment with various toppings, such as pickled jalapeños or cilantro, to give your tacos a unique twist.
Baja-Style Fish Tacos with Zesty Lime Crema
Try our Baja-Style Fish Tacos for a taste adventure. Each bite is fresh from the sea and zesty with lime. It’s a mix of Mexican flavors and a twist on traditional tacos.
Selecting the Right Fish
The right fish is key for Baja-Style Fish Tacos. Choose a firm and flaky fish like cod or tilapia. These fish are great for battering and frying. Their mild taste complements the dish’s bold flavors.
Ingredients for Fish and Crema
Here’s what you need for our Baja-Style Fish Tacos:
- 1 pound of cod or tilapia, cut into small pieces
- 1 cup of all-purpose flour
- 1/2 teaspoon of paprika
- 1/4 teaspoon of cayenne pepper
- 1/2 cup of buttermilk
- Vegetable oil for frying
- For the crema: 1 cup of sour cream, 2 tablespoons of freshly squeezed lime juice, 1 minced garlic clove, Salt to taste
Cooking Instructions
First, make the zesty lime crema. Mix all the ingredients in a bowl and chill it until serving time. For the fish, dip each piece in buttermilk, then coat in flour, shaking off extra. Fry until golden and crispy. Drain on paper towels.
Assembly Tips
To assemble the tacos, place fried fish on a warmed tortilla. Add a dollop of zesty lime crema, diced tomatoes, and cilantro. Serve right away and enjoy the mix of flavors and textures.
Protein-Packed Vegetarian Black Bean Tacos
Looking for a meat-free meal that’s both nutritious and tasty? Try protein-packed vegetarian black bean tacos. They’re a great source of protein and fiber, making them a healthy and satisfying choice.
Ingredients for Bean Filling
To make the bean filling, you’ll need the following ingredients:
- 1 cup dried black beans, soaked overnight and drained
- 1 onion, diced
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 red bell pepper, diced
- 1 teaspoon cumin
- 1 teaspoon chili powder
- Salt and pepper, to taste
Cooking Process
Start by sautéing the onion, garlic, and red bell pepper in a large pan until they’re tender. Then, add the soaked black beans, cumin, chili powder, salt, and pepper. Stir well to combine. Add 2 cups of water and bring to a boil. Reduce the heat to low and simmer for about 20-25 minutes, or until the beans are tender.
Once the beans are cooked, use a fork to mash some of them against the side of the pan. This creates a creamy texture that helps hold the filling together.
Topping Ideas
To enhance your vegetarian black bean tacos, consider these toppings:
Topping | Description | Benefits |
---|---|---|
Avocado | Creamy and rich, adds healthy fats | Enhances flavor and texture |
Salsa | Spicy and tangy, made with fresh ingredients | Adds a burst of flavor |
Shredded Lettuce | Crunchy and fresh, adds fiber and vitamins | Provides a refreshing contrast |

Melt-in-Your-Mouth Slow Cooker Carnitas Tacos
Craving tender and juicy carnitas tacos? A slow cooker is your best friend. It makes sure your carnitas are perfectly cooked and ready to eat.
Ingredients for Tender Carnitas
To make the best carnitas, you need a few key ingredients. You’ll need 2 pounds of pork shoulder, cut into large chunks. Also, 1/4 cup of orange juice and 1/4 cup of lime juice are needed. Plus, 4 cloves of garlic, minced, 1 teaspoon of dried oregano, and 1/2 teaspoon of cumin. Don’t forget salt and pepper to taste.
Slow Cooker Method
Put the pork chunks, orange and lime juice, garlic, oregano, cumin, salt, and pepper in the slow cooker. Cook on low for 8-10 hours or on high for 4-6 hours. The pork should be tender and easily shreddable.
Overnight Preparation Tips
For an even easier meal, prepare your carnitas overnight. Just set your slow cooker to cook on low for 8 hours while you sleep.
Final Crisping Technique
After cooking, shred the pork and spread it on a baking sheet. Broil in the oven for a few minutes until the edges are crispy. This adds a nice texture contrast to your soft tacos.
Serving Suggestions
Serve your carnitas in warm tacos with your favorite toppings. Some great options include diced onions, cilantro, salsa, and lime wedges. Here’s a simple table to help you plan your taco toppings:
Topping | Description |
---|---|
Diced Onions | Add a sweet and crunchy texture |
Cilantro | Provides a fresh and herbal flavor |
Salsa | Spicy and tangy, adds a burst of flavor |

Spicy Shrimp Tacos with Creamy Avocado Salsa
Looking for a taco recipe that’s spicy and refreshing? Try these Spicy Shrimp Tacos with Creamy Avocado Salsa. It’s great for those who enjoy a mix of heat and coolness.
Ingredients for Shrimp and Salsa
Here’s what you need for these tasty tacos:
- 1 pound large shrimp, peeled and deveined
- 1/2 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1/4 teaspoon smoked paprika
- 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
- 2 ripe avocados, diced
- 1/2 red onion, finely chopped
- 1 jalapeño pepper, seeded and finely chopped
- 1/4 cup cilantro, chopped
- 2 tablespoons lime juice
- Salt and pepper to taste
Cooking Perfect Shrimp
Cooking the shrimp right is key. Here’s how:
- Heat a skillet over medium-high heat.
- Add a tablespoon of oil and swirl it around.
- Add the shrimp and cook for 2-3 minutes per side until they’re pink and cooked through.
- Remove the shrimp from the skillet and set them aside to rest.
Making Fresh Avocado Salsa
Making the avocado salsa is easy. Just mix the diced avocado, chopped red onion, jalapeño, cilantro, and lime juice in a bowl. Add salt and pepper to taste.
Assembly Instructions
To make the tacos, place a few cooked shrimp on a warmed taco shell. Top with avocado salsa and serve right away.

Crispy Buffalo Cauliflower Tacos for Meat-Free Monday
Try making Crispy Buffalo Cauliflower Tacos for a tasty, healthy vegetarian meal. It’s perfect for Meat-Free Monday or any day you want a fulfilling vegetarian dish.
Ingredients for Vegetarian Buffalo Tacos
Here’s what you need: – 1 head of cauliflower, broken into florets – 1/2 cup of buffalo sauce – 1/4 cup of olive oil – 2 cloves of garlic, minced – 1 teaspoon of cumin – 1/2 teaspoon of paprika – Salt and pepper to taste – 8-10 corn tortillas – Avocado or vegan sour cream for topping (optional)
These ingredients mix to make a spicy, savory dish. The cauliflower adds a nice crunch.
Baking Perfect Cauliflower
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Mix the cauliflower florets with olive oil, garlic, cumin, paprika, salt, and pepper on a baking sheet. Roast for 20-25 minutes, until tender and slightly caramelized.
Then, toss the cauliflower with buffalo sauce until coated. Bake for 10-15 minutes more, until crispy.
Cauliflower Preparation Step | Time | Temperature |
---|---|---|
Roasting | 20-25 minutes | 425°F (220°C) |
Baking with buffalo sauce | 10-15 minutes | 425°F (220°C) |
Complementary Toppings
Put the crispy buffalo cauliflower in corn tortillas. Add toppings like diced tomatoes, shredded lettuce, diced avocado, or vegan sour cream. These tacos are a flavorful, meat-free option.
